Spring Boot云端数据监控系统:实时可视化与管理

需积分: 50 13 下载量 100 浏览量 更新于2024-08-13 3 收藏 839KB PDF 举报
"该文介绍了一个基于Spring Boot的云端数据监控与可视化应用系统,用于管理与实时展示存储在云端的空气质量数据。系统采用B/S架构,利用Spring Boot框架构建后端微服务,Vue.js框架处理前端页面,Axios插件进行数据交互,实现了数据的实时监控、下载、报警管理和百度地图的可视化功能。系统部署在阿里云上,便于用户远程访问。" 本文主要探讨了如何构建一个基于Spring Boot的云端数据监控管理与可视化应用系统,用于有效管理和实时展示云端存储的空气质量数据。系统采用了B/S(Browser/Server)架构,这种架构使得用户可以通过浏览器进行操作,降低了用户的使用门槛。Spring Boot作为后端开发框架,简化了系统的配置和监控,提高了开发效率。Spring Boot的微服务特性使得系统更易于扩展和维护。 在前端开发中,采用了Vue.js框架,这是一种轻量级的JavaScript框架,用于构建用户界面。Vue.js的组件化开发模式使得代码结构清晰,提高了开发效率,同时提供了丰富的功能,如数据绑定和事件处理,使得前端页面动态交互更为流畅。 数据交互是通过Axios插件封装的Ajax技术实现的。Ajax允许前后端数据的异步传输,减少了服务器的负担,提高了响应速度。Axios是一个基于Promise的HTTP库,它在前端和后端都可使用,提供了易于理解和使用的API,使得数据请求和处理更加便捷。 系统能够监控11种关键的空气成分,包括PM1.0、PM2.5、PM10、CO、CO2、NO、NO2、O3、SO2、甲醛和TVOC,以及相关的环境参数如温度、湿度、风速和地理位置等。这些数据的实时监控和可视化有助于环境监测和分析。 此外,系统还提供了数据下载功能,用户可以下载历史数据进行进一步分析。报警管理功能则能及时提醒用户空气质量的异常变化。通过集成百度地图,系统实现了地理空间上的数据可视化,帮助用户直观地了解空气质量分布情况。 最后,该系统部署在阿里云平台上,这确保了系统的稳定性和可访问性,用户无论身处何处,只要有网络连接,都能远程访问并使用这个系统。Spring Boot和Vue的结合实现了前后端分离,提升了系统的性能、稳定性和实时响应能力。 总结来说,这个基于Spring Boot的云端数据监控与可视化应用系统是一个高效、稳定且实时的解决方案,对于空气质量监测和环境管理具有重要的实际应用价值。